Calakmul, one of the largest Mayan cities in the classical period, was a major rival to Tikal (Guatemala), which it dominated during the 7C. Heavily pillaged and long inaccessible due to being buried deep in the jungle (biosphere reserve), Calakmul now proudly displays its royal tombs (see the jade mosaic masks exhibited in the museum in Campeche) and bas-reliefs steles. The magical vision from atop structure 2 extends over the forest dotted with pyramids as far as the eye can see.
